-# jsesc [![Build status](https://travis-ci.org/mathiasbynens/jsesc.svg?branch=master)](https://travis-ci.org/mathiasbynens/jsesc) [![Code coverage status](http://img.shields.io/coveralls/mathiasbynens/jsesc/master.svg)](https://coveralls.io/r/mathiasbynens/jsesc) [![Dependency status](https://gemnasium.com/mathiasbynens/jsesc.svg)](https://gemnasium.com/mathiasbynens/jsesc)
-
-This is a JavaScript library for [escaping JavaScript strings](http://mathiasbynens.be/notes/javascript-escapes) while generating the shortest possible valid ASCII-only output. [Here’s an online demo.](http://mothereff.in/js-escapes)
-
-This can be used to avoid [mojibake](http://en.wikipedia.org/wiki/Mojibake) and other encoding issues, or even to [avoid errors](https://twitter.com/annevk/status/380000829643571200) when passing JSON-formatted data (which may contain U+2028 LINE SEPARATOR, U+2029 PARAGRAPH SEPARATOR, or [lone surrogates](http://esdiscuss.org/topic/code-points-vs-unicode-scalar-values#content-14)) to a JavaScript parser or an UTF-8 encoder, respectively.

-## API
-
-### `jsesc(value, options)`
-
-This function takes a value and returns an escaped version of the value where any characters that are not printable ASCII symbols are escaped using the shortest possible (but valid) [escape sequences for use in JavaScript strings](http://mathiasbynens.be/notes/javascript-escapes). The first supported value type is strings:
-
-```js
-jsesc('Ich ♥ Bücher');
-// → 'Ich \\u2665 B\\xFCcher'
-
-jsesc('foo 𝌆 bar');
-// → 'foo \\uD834\\uDF06 bar'
-```
-
-Instead of a string, the `value` can also be an array, or an object. In such cases, `jsesc` will return a stringified version of the value where any characters that are not printable ASCII symbols are escaped in the same way.
-
-```js
-// Escaping an array
-jsesc([
- 'Ich ♥ Bücher', 'foo 𝌆 bar'
-]);
-// → '[\'Ich \\u2665 B\\xFCcher\',\'foo \\uD834\\uDF06 bar\']'
-
-// Escaping an object
-jsesc({
- 'Ich ♥ Bücher': 'foo 𝌆 bar'
-});
-// → '{\'Ich \\u2665 B\\xFCcher\':\'foo \\uD834\\uDF06 bar\'}'
-```
-
-The optional `options` argument accepts an object with the following options:
-
-#### `quotes`
-
-The default value for the `quotes` option is `'single'`. This means that any occurences of `'` in the input string will be escaped as `\'`, so that the output can be used in a string literal wrapped in single quotes.
-
-```js
-jsesc('Lorem ipsum "dolor" sit \'amet\' etc.');
-// → 'Lorem ipsum "dolor" sit \\\'amet\\\' etc.'
-
-jsesc('Lorem ipsum "dolor" sit \'amet\' etc.', {
- 'quotes': 'single'
-});
-// → 'Lorem ipsum "dolor" sit \\\'amet\\\' etc.'
-// → "Lorem ipsum \"dolor\" sit \\'amet\\' etc."
-```
-
-If you want to use the output as part of a string literal wrapped in double quotes, set the `quotes` option to `'double'`.
-
-```js
-jsesc('Lorem ipsum "dolor" sit \'amet\' etc.', {
- 'quotes': 'double'
-});
-// → 'Lorem ipsum \\"dolor\\" sit \'amet\' etc.'
-// → "Lorem ipsum \\\"dolor\\\" sit 'amet' etc."
-```
-
-This setting also affects the output for arrays and objects:
-
-```js
-jsesc({ 'Ich ♥ Bücher': 'foo 𝌆 bar' }, {
- 'quotes': 'double'
-});
-// → '{"Ich \\u2665 B\\xFCcher":"foo \\uD834\\uDF06 bar"}'
-
-jsesc([ 'Ich ♥ Bücher', 'foo 𝌆 bar' ], {
- 'quotes': 'double'
-});
-// → '["Ich \\u2665 B\\xFCcher","foo \\uD834\\uDF06 bar"]'
-```

-#### `wrap`
-
-The `wrap` option takes a boolean value (`true` or `false`), and defaults to `false` (disabled). When enabled, the output will be a valid JavaScript string literal wrapped in quotes. The type of quotes can be specified through the `quotes` setting.
-
-```js
-jsesc('Lorem ipsum "dolor" sit \'amet\' etc.', {
- 'quotes': 'single',
- 'wrap': true
-});
-// → '\'Lorem ipsum "dolor" sit \\\'amet\\\' etc.\''
-// → "\'Lorem ipsum \"dolor\" sit \\\'amet\\\' etc.\'"
-
-jsesc('Lorem ipsum "dolor" sit \'amet\' etc.', {
- 'quotes': 'double',
- 'wrap': true
-});
-// → '"Lorem ipsum \\"dolor\\" sit \'amet\' etc."'
-// → "\"Lorem ipsum \\\"dolor\\\" sit \'amet\' etc.\""
-```
-
-#### `es6`
-
-The `es6` option takes a boolean value (`true` or `false`), and defaults to `false` (disabled). When enabled, any astral Unicode symbols in the input will be escaped using [ECMAScript 6 Unicode code point escape sequences](http://mathiasbynens.be/notes/javascript-escapes#unicode-code-point) instead of using separate escape sequences for each surrogate half. If backwards compatibility with ES5 environments is a concern, don’t enable this setting. If the `json` setting is enabled, the value for the `es6` setting is ignored (as if it was `false`).
-
-```js
-// By default, the `es6` option is disabled:
-jsesc('foo 𝌆 bar 💩 baz');
-// → 'foo \\uD834\\uDF06 bar \\uD83D\\uDCA9 baz'
-
-// To explicitly disable it:
-jsesc('foo 𝌆 bar 💩 baz', {
- 'es6': false
-});
-// → 'foo \\uD834\\uDF06 bar \\uD83D\\uDCA9 baz'
-
-// To enable it:
-jsesc('foo 𝌆 bar 💩 baz', {
- 'es6': true
-});
-// → 'foo \\u{1D306} bar \\u{1F4A9} baz'
-```
-
-#### `escapeEverything`
-
-The `escapeEverything` option takes a boolean value (`true` or `false`), and defaults to `false` (disabled). When enabled, all the symbols in the output will be escaped, even printable ASCII symbols.
-
-```js
-jsesc('lolwat"foo\'bar', {
- 'escapeEverything': true
-});
-// → '\\x6C\\x6F\\x6C\\x77\\x61\\x74\\"\\x66\\x6F\\x6F\\\'\\x62\\x61\\x72'
-// → "\\x6C\\x6F\\x6C\\x77\\x61\\x74\\\"\\x66\\x6F\\x6F\\'\\x62\\x61\\x72"
-```
-
-This setting also affects the output for arrays and objects:
-
-```js
-jsesc({ 'Ich ♥ Bücher': 'foo 𝌆 bar' }, {
- 'escapeEverything': true
-});
-// → '{\'\x49\x63\x68\x20\u2665\x20\x42\xFC\x63\x68\x65\x72\':\'\x66\x6F\x6F\x20\uD834\uDF06\x20\x62\x61\x72\'}'
-// → "{'\x49\x63\x68\x20\u2665\x20\x42\xFC\x63\x68\x65\x72':'\x66\x6F\x6F\x20\uD834\uDF06\x20\x62\x61\x72'}"
-
-jsesc([ 'Ich ♥ Bücher': 'foo 𝌆 bar' ], {
- 'escapeEverything': true
-});
-// → '[\'\x49\x63\x68\x20\u2665\x20\x42\xFC\x63\x68\x65\x72\',\'\x66\x6F\x6F\x20\uD834\uDF06\x20\x62\x61\x72\']'
-```
-
-#### `compact`
-
-The `compact` option takes a boolean value (`true` or `false`), and defaults to `true` (enabled). When enabled, the output for arrays and objects will be as compact as possible; it won’t be formatted nicely.
-
-```js
-jsesc({ 'Ich ♥ Bücher': 'foo 𝌆 bar' }, {
- 'compact': true // this is the default
-});
-// → '{\'Ich \u2665 B\xFCcher\':\'foo \uD834\uDF06 bar\'}'
-
-jsesc({ 'Ich ♥ Bücher': 'foo 𝌆 bar' }, {
- 'compact': false
-});
-// → '{\n\t\'Ich \u2665 B\xFCcher\': \'foo \uD834\uDF06 bar\'\n}'
-
-jsesc([ 'Ich ♥ Bücher', 'foo 𝌆 bar' ], {
- 'compact': false
-});
-// → '[\n\t\'Ich \u2665 B\xFCcher\',\n\t\'foo \uD834\uDF06 bar\'\n]'
-```
-
-This setting has no effect on the output for strings.
-
-#### `indent`
-
-The `indent` option takes a string value, and defaults to `'\t'`. When the `compact` setting is enabled (`true`), the value of the `indent` option is used to format the output for arrays and objects.
-
-```js
-jsesc({ 'Ich ♥ Bücher': 'foo 𝌆 bar' }, {
- 'compact': false,
- 'indent': '\t' // this is the default
-});
-// → '{\n\t\'Ich \u2665 B\xFCcher\': \'foo \uD834\uDF06 bar\'\n}'
-
-jsesc({ 'Ich ♥ Bücher': 'foo 𝌆 bar' }, {
- 'compact': false,
- 'indent': ' '
-});
-// → '{\n \'Ich \u2665 B\xFCcher\': \'foo \uD834\uDF06 bar\'\n}'
-
-jsesc([ 'Ich ♥ Bücher', 'foo 𝌆 bar' ], {
- 'compact': false,
- 'indent': ' '
-});
-// → '[\n \'Ich \u2665 B\xFCcher\',\n\ t\'foo \uD834\uDF06 bar\'\n]'
-```
-
-This setting has no effect on the output for strings.
-
-#### `json`
-
-The `json` option takes a boolean value (`true` or `false`), and defaults to `false` (disabled). When enabled, the output is valid JSON. [Hexadecimal character escape sequences](http://mathiasbynens.be/notes/javascript-escapes#hexadecimal) and [the `\v` or `\0` escape sequences](http://mathiasbynens.be/notes/javascript-escapes#single) will not be used. Setting `json: true` implies `quotes: 'double', wrap: true, es6: false`, although these values can still be overridden if needed — but in such cases, the output won’t be valid JSON anymore.
-
-```js
-jsesc('foo\x00bar\xFF\uFFFDbaz', {
- 'json': true
-});
-// → '"foo\\u0000bar\\u00FF\\uFFFDbaz"'
-
-jsesc({ 'foo\x00bar\xFF\uFFFDbaz': 'foo\x00bar\xFF\uFFFDbaz' }, {
- 'json': true
-});
-// → '{"foo\\u0000bar\\u00FF\\uFFFDbaz":"foo\\u0000bar\\u00FF\\uFFFDbaz"}'
-
-jsesc([ 'foo\x00bar\xFF\uFFFDbaz', 'foo\x00bar\xFF\uFFFDbaz' ], {
- 'json': true
-});
-// → '["foo\\u0000bar\\u00FF\\uFFFDbaz","foo\\u0000bar\\u00FF\\uFFFDbaz"]'
-
-// Values that are acceptable in JSON but aren’t strings, arrays, or object
-// literals can’t be escaped, so they’ll just be preserved:
-jsesc([ 'foo\x00bar', [1, '©', { 'foo': true, 'qux': null }], 42 ], {
- 'json': true
-});
-// → '["foo\\u0000bar",[1,"\\u00A9",{"foo":true,"qux":null}],42]'
-// Values that aren’t allowed in JSON are run through `JSON.stringify()`:
-jsesc([ undefined, -Infinity ], {
- 'json': true
-});
-// → '[null,null]'
-```
-
-**Note:** Using this option on objects or arrays that contain non-string values relies on `JSON.stringify()`. For legacy environments like IE ≤ 7, use [a `JSON` polyfill](http://bestiejs.github.io/json3/).

-### Using the `jsesc` binary
-
-To use the `jsesc` binary in your shell, simply install jsesc globally using npm:
-
-```bash
-npm install -g jsesc
-```
-
-After that you will be able to escape strings from the command line:
-
-```bash
-$ jsesc 'föo ♥ bår 𝌆 baz'
-f\xF6o \u2665 b\xE5r \uD834\uDF06 baz
-```
-
-To escape arrays or objects containing string values, use the `-o`/`--object` option:
-
-```bash
-$ jsesc --object '{ "föo": "♥", "bår": "𝌆 baz" }'
-{'f\xF6o':'\u2665','b\xE5r':'\uD834\uDF06 baz'}
-```
-
-To prettify the output in such cases, use the `-p`/`--pretty` option:
-
-```bash
-$ jsesc --pretty '{ "föo": "♥", "bår": "𝌆 baz" }'
-{
- 'f\xF6o': '\u2665',
- 'b\xE5r': '\uD834\uDF06 baz'
-}
-```
-
-For valid JSON output, use the `-j`/`--json` option:
-
-```bash
-$ jsesc --json --pretty '{ "föo": "♥", "bår": "𝌆 baz" }'
-{
- "f\u00F6o": "\u2665",
- "b\u00E5r": "\uD834\uDF06 baz"
-}
-```
-
-Read a local JSON file, escape any non-ASCII symbols, and save the result to a new file:
-
-```bash
-$ jsesc --json --object < data-raw.json > data-escaped.json
-```
-
-Or do the same with an online JSON file:
-
-```bash
-$ curl -sL "http://git.io/aorKgQ" | jsesc --json --object > data-escaped.json
-```
-
-See `jsesc --help` for the full list of options.
